What an Emergency Warden Is Actually For
A great warden lowers uncertainty. On a normal day they examine departures and illumination, maintain evacuation representations existing, and push centers when an egress route is obstructed. Throughout an emergency situation they pay attention, interpret, and act. The benchmark is quiet capability, not heroics.
The PUA training structure in Australia gives 2 beneficial devices for developing that skills. The initial, PUAER005 Run as part of an emergency control organisation, gears up wardens with the fundamentals: identifying threats, responding to alarm systems, interacting with the chief warden, assisting individuals evacuate, and aiding very first responders. Numerous providers describe it as the PUAER005 program, or shorthand it as puafer005. The second, PUAER006 Lead an emergency control organisation, is for those that will certainly run the show. You will see it referred to as the puafer006 course, and it covers command functions, decision making, and liaison with emergency services at an incident control point.
The criteria provide a scaffold, yet results rely on context. A circulation centre with forklifts and LPG cyndrical tubes requires different drills to a store street-front store. The goals are common - move people out, isolate risks, maintain info flowing - yet the way you arrive varies.
The Emergency Control Organisation, From Floor Warden to Chief
In most workplaces the emergency control organisation, or ECO, consists of a chief warden, deputies, flooring or area wardens, first aiders, and communications sustain. Some duties overlap. In smaller websites one trained person may carry multiple responsibilities.
Chief wardens route the reaction. They confirm the alarm system, make a decision whether to evacuate and just how, assign wardens to areas, liaise with emergency solutions, and take obligation for the head count and the information that informs tactical decisions. The puafer006 lead an emergency control organisation device is created for this job. It is not a ceremonial title. When the fire panel blares, the chief warden holds the string that keeps points from unraveling.
Area or floor wardens, educated through puafer005, conduct sweeps, guide emptyings, look for mobility needs, close doors behind the last evacuees, and report condition to the principal. In one multi-tenant office we sustain, six floor wardens manage 1,200 residents during drills. Their reports - West Staircase clear, Floor 17 clear, two contractors staying with a warden as a result of wheelchair - get developed into quick decisions by the chief: hold lifts, redirect to East Stair, paramedics to Degree 10.
In storehouses, ECOs might add a website traffic controller duty to stop vehicle movement, and a plant seclusion function to shut down conveyors or compressors. Retail websites often mark a client mustering role, since customers require a clear voice and a directing hand more than an alarm.

Fire Warden Needs in the Workplace
Every jurisdiction establishes minimums, and they transform over time, so validate locally. A defensible standard across several industries resembles this: nominate wardens so that each floor or location has coverage during all shifts, educate them to PUAER005 or an equal requirement, freshen every year, and run at least one sensible emptying exercise yearly. High structures usually run 2, one announced and one unannounced, to keep the process honest.
Fire warden demands must be constructed into function summaries. Volunteers are necessary, but resourcing can not rely upon goodwill alone. Administration support matters. When team know that time spent on emergency warden training is identified as work, presence and involvement increase. When an audit lands, you will desire training certificates, attendance sheets, ECO lineups, and proof of workouts with corrective activities shut out.
Special risks require extra steps. If your discount store Class 3 combustible fluids, you require spill feedback training and ideal snuffing out media accessible. If your retail website runs seasonal pop-ups that change egress paths, update your discharge diagrams and quick staff, not simply wardens. Fire warden training requirements are not fixed, they track the website's threat profile.

Offices: Silent Risks, Huge Numbers
Office emptyings are generally organized, yet the scale can stun you. As soon as a smoked toaster oven set off a full-building alarm in a 20-storey tower and greater than 2,000 individuals boiled down 2 stairwells in 14 mins. The chief warden's decision to hold the lobby while a ward warden reported on the resource stopped a counterflow jam when firemens arrived.
For offices, focus training on staircase monitoring, regulated use lifts, assisting mobility-impaired occupants, and precise headcounts. The puafer005 operate as part of an emergency control organisation unit provides wardens the ideal language for sweeps and records. Show them to close but not secure doors, to inspect restrooms, and to avoid sending people into smoke. Chief warden responsibilities consist of collaborating with building monitoring, notifying tenants, and rundown initial -responders with area, status of emptying, and anyones remaining in place with a warden.
Practical details issue. In modern-day offices with accessibility control, badge viewers typically fail in a power cut. Issue mechanical secrets to wardens or fit secure locks where proper. Keep a paper listing of movement requires in the warden kit, due to the fact that relying upon a cloud directory throughout an emergency situation is a gamble.
Warehouses: Noise, Equipment, and Distance
In a storehouse, the risks are much less refined. Forklifts move between racks, mezzanines forget packing lines, and compressed gas cyndrical tubes rest near roller doors. Draw stations can be blocked by pallets. Distinct alarms can be muffled by conveyors. Your warden course needs to attend to these truths head on.
Start with closure. That can quit car motions, who can shut out conveyors, that recognizes where the gas isolation is? Appoint those duties to wardens and drill till they can do it blindfolded. Next off, clear interaction. Radios need to be checked weekly, not simply on drill day. Train wardens to use simple, concurred expressions: Evacuate using Door 4, West Mezzanine clear, Cylinder Bay pending. The chief fire warden responsibilities include designating a risk-free setting up area upwind of likely smoke travel, and adjusting paths if a door is compromised.
Vertical travel includes intricacy. If your site has staircases to mezzanine workplaces, ensure wardens understand where to organize people if smoke exists below. Pre-plan for roll cages or pallets obstructing egress. I have actually seen a drill delay for 3 mins because 2 cages jammed in the exit, waiting on somebody to act. It is much better to exercise moving small obstacles than to wish people will certainly improvise well.
Retail: Consumers Initially, After That Stock
Retail brings the human variable front and center. Team recognize the store, customers do not. You need a calmness, visible presence to lead individuals out via a route that may not be their entrance factor. Fire warden training for retail need to cover public address manuscripts, hand signals in noisy spaces, and crowd administration without panic.
For a department store with several leaves and escalators, train wardens to direct customers far from smoke, to prefer directly, wide aisles, and to watch on prams and mobility devices. In one discharge at a rural facility, a solitary warden's choice to hold an escalator until the smoke curtain went down protected against a dangerous traffic jam. Chief fire warden duties here consist of informing bordering lessees if your store's event might impact shared areas, and collaborating with facility management.
Seasonal adjustments can weaken excellent plans. Pop-up components and discount rate containers slip into aisles, and personnel end up being callous them. Make the fire warden requirements in the workplace specific: prior to each trading day, wardens inspect egress courses and eliminate obstructions. During late-night stocktakes, guarantee the ECO lineup covers the change, not simply nine-to-five.

Drills That Educate Something
A drill with no understanding purpose is theater. Establish clear purposes, then design situations that evaluate them. For instance, in a storehouse, imitate a little fire near the cyndrical tube shop and see whether the isolation and emptying courses hold. In an office, mark one stairwell as obstructed and validate that people flow to the detours efficiently. In retail, examination public address clarity by having a warden deliver a short manuscript over a real-time system.
Keep the brief short and the debrief concentrated. Great debriefs are straightforward without blame. Action performance by time to very first decision, time to all-clear of zones, interaction clarity, and whether wardens followed the strategy. Close the loop by repairing problems: relocate a sign, replace a sticky door better, re-train a warden that obtained rattled. Documents issues, but it is the repair that reduces risk.
Radios, Alarm systems, and the Silent Bat Cave
Technology assists when it is simple and maintained. Handheld radios with extra batteries defeat smart device messaging when networks choke. Label networks by feature, not simply numbers. Place the chief fire warden on a committed web with the wardens, while facilities connects with the fire indicator panel on one more. If your site makes use of a warden intercom phone system at the panel, train on it, not just the radios.
Alarm tones can perplex. Quick your people on what various tones imply and check the system so tones are distinct in noisy spaces. In a storehouse with ultrasonic packaging machines, we mounted aesthetic strobes to capture attention. In an office with a quiet floor, the very same strobes triggered problems since they were as well bright. Song remedies to place.
Every ECO requires a silent bat cave, a set factor where the principal can think. It may https://www.firstaidpro.com.au/course/puafer005/ be the fire control space, a filling dock, or an entrance hall corner. Stock it with a warden kit: layout, high-vis vests, a small whiteboard with pens, spare radios, flashlight, and a printed call listing. Keep the kit sealed and inspected month-to-month. Throughout one actual emptying, a dead radio battery forced a jogger system that included minutes. That is time you can redeem with tiny habits.
Extinguishers and the Choice Not to Fight
Wardens often get standard first attack training, and puafer005 consists of secure use of fire extinguishers and fire blankets. It is crucial, and it can be dangerous. Educate the PASS series, yet also show judgment. If the fire is bigger than a trash can, if it is climbing, if smoke is dropping below head elevation, or if the path to your back is not guaranteed, do not engage. Close the door, increase the alarm system, and evacuate.
In warehouses, do not utilize water on invigorated tools or on flammable liquid spills. In retail, a small lithium-ion battery fire from an e-scooter can flare violently; isolate, utilize a completely dry chemical or water mist where offered, and evacuate early. Videotape near misses to find patterns and freshen training where complacency creeps in.
The Human Side: Stress And Anxiety, Wheelchair, and Visitors
Not every barrier is physical. Some individuals freeze. Others intend to gather individual items. Wardens ought to be shown simple expressions that break the loophole: Follow me, we are going in this manner, leave it, the structure is secure outside. In a workplace we trained, a warden walked beside an anxious coworker down 12 trips, chatting gently concerning the cafe they would certainly go to at the setting up location. It is management as much as logistics.
Mobility preparation need to specify. Determine people who need aid and settle on a plan they are comfortable with. Lots of buildings make use of sanctuary factors at stairwells where individuals wait with a warden up until firefighters arrive, or where they are helped down with an emptying chair. Train on the chair. Keep it easily accessible, not locked in a cabinet behind boxes.
Visitors complicate counting. Make use of a sign-in system you can access offline, and instruct function team to hand visitor passes to a warden at evacuation. In retail, staff ought to be educated to stay clear of head counts that consist of clients, yet to perform a fast check for any individual left behind, specifically in fitting rooms and restrooms.
Common Risks and Just how to Stay clear of Them
The exact same errors repeat throughout websites. Radios are not billed. Wardens forget their function cards. Exit routes are blocked by deliveries. Specialists disable detectors and fail to remember to inform the principal. Drills run at foreseeable times and become a checkbox.
A functional technique is to install small look into day-to-day regimens. Wardens stroll their path at the start of shift. Facilities runs a weekly radio check. Safety validates the fire indicator panel is devoid of faults throughout their patrol. The chief warden responsibilities need to include a quarterly ECO conference to evaluate cases and adjustments. Spread out the lots and make it normal.
